Ingredients
Main Ingredients
– 4 salmon fillets
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 4 cloves garlic, minced
– Juice and zest of 1 lemon
– 2 cups asparagus, trimmed
– 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
The main ingredients are simple but packed with flavor. Salmon is the star here. It cooks quickly and is very healthy. The olive oil adds richness. Garlic gives a sharp taste. Fresh lemon brightens every bite, making it fresh and zesty. Asparagus and cherry tomatoes add color and nutrients.
Seasoning and Garnish
– 1 teaspoon honey
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Seasoning is crucial for this dish. Honey balances the garlic and lemon. Salt and pepper bring out all the flavors. Fresh parsley adds a pop of green and freshness at the end. It makes the dish look pretty too.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paration Steps
1.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This step helps cook the salmon evenly.
2. In a small bowl, combine 2 tablespoons of olive oil, 4 minced garlic cloves, lemon juice, lemon zest, 1 teaspoon of honey, salt, and pepper. Whisk these ingredients until they blend well. This mixture gives a bright, zesty flavor to the salmon.
Arranging the Ingredients
1. On a large sheet pan lined with parchment paper, place the 4 salmon fillets on one side. Brush them generously with the lemon garlic mixture. This adds moisture and flavor.
2. On the other side of the pan, add 2 cups of trimmed asparagus and 1 cup of halved cherry tomatoes. Drizzle the remaining lemon garlic mixture over the vegetables and toss them gently. Spread the veggies out in a single layer. This helps them roast evenly.
Baking Process
1. Bake the sheet pan in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es. The salmon should be cooked through and flake easily with a fork. The vegetables should be tender and slightly caramelized.
2. To check for doneness, look for the salmon to turn a light pink. You can also use a fork to see if it flakes. Once done, remove the pan from the oven and let it rest for a couple of minutes.

Tips & Tricks
Enhancing Flavor
To make your sheet pan lemon garlic salmon even better, try adding herbs like dill or thyme. These herbs pair well with salmon and add a fresh taste. You can also use spices like paprika or cumin for a different kick. For sweetness, if you want to switch from honey, try maple syrup or agave. These options will still bring a nice balance to the dish.
Cooking Techniques
For a crispy top, broiling at the end is a great trick. Broil the salmon for 2-3 minutes after baking. Keep a close eye to avoid burning. To ensure your salmon is just right, use a meat thermometer. The ideal internal temperature is 145°F. This way, you avoid overcooking and keep it tender.

Variations
Different Protein Options
You can switch up the protein in this dish easily. If you want chicken, use boneless, skinless thighs. They cook well and soak up flavors nicely. Cut them into pieces and follow the same steps. For shrimp, use large, peeled shrimp. They cook faster, so watch them closely in the oven. Both options add a new twist to the meal.
If you prefer plant-based options, try tofu or tempeh. Press and cube the tofu for best results. Marinate it just like the salmon. This method allows the tofu to absorb all that lemon garlic goodness. Tempeh can also work well. Use a similar cooking time for both.
Seasonal Vegetable Swaps
You can change the vegetables based on what’s fresh. In spring, broccoli is a great choice. It adds a nice crunch and green color. In summer, bell peppers bring sweetness and flavor. Just cut them into strips and toss them in.
In fall, consider squash or Brussels sprouts. They pair well with the salmon’s taste. During winter, root vegetables like carrots or parsnips make a hearty addition. Adjust cooking times as needed to ensure everything cooks evenly.
Marinade Alternatives
The marinade is where you can get creative. Instead of lemon, try orange or lime juice. These fruits add a different flavor but keep the dish bright. Grapefruit can also work if you like a bolder taste.
For an Asian twist, swap lemon juice for soy sauce or teriyaki sauce. This change creates a unique flavor profile. Just remember to adjust the sweetness if you use teriyaki. The choice of marinade can transform the whole dish while keeping it simple.

Storage Info
Storing Leftovers
To keep your sheet pan lemon garlic salmon fresh, follow these tips:
– Refrigeration: Place leftovers in an airtight container. This keeps out air and moisture. Store in the fridge for up to three days.
– Freezing: For longer storage, freeze in a freezer-safe container. It can last for up to three months. Make sure to wrap it well to avoid freezer burn.
Reheating Instructions
When you’re ready to eat, reheating is key to keeping the salmon nice. Here’s how:
– Oven Method: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the salmon on a baking dish. Cover with foil to keep moisture in. Heat for about 15 minutes.
– Microwave Method: Use a microwave-safe plate. Cover the salmon with a damp paper towel. Heat in 30-second intervals until warm, about 1-2 minutes.
Shelf Life
Knowing how long your meal lasts is important. Here are some details:
– In the Fridge: You can keep your salmon leftovers for up to three days.
– Signs of Spoilage: Check for a sour smell, dull color, or slimy texture. If you see any of these, it’s best to toss it.
